Demonic Dwelling is one of those films that straddles the line between comedy and horror in a way that feels refreshingly unique. The mockumentary style adds this layer of absurdity, following a ghost hunting crew as they bumble through their investigation at the Farrow House—definitely not the most seasoned bunch. The pacing is deliberately uneven, which kind of enhances the awkwardness of their encounters, making it feel all the more real. The practical effects are charmingly low-budget, which adds an endearing quality to the scares. The performances are spot on, capturing that mix of bravado and skepticism you'd expect from amateur ghost hunters. It's quirky and light-hearted, but it has its spooky moments too, creating a pretty interesting atmosphere.
